Hi,
I'm having some trouble with the testsuite. The daily builds are not
updating, and it looks like it's because the testsuite for phpMyAdmin
5.0-snapshot is failing (ultimately, MySQL on the build server doesn't
allow the testsuite to authenticate with the stored credentials, but I
think that's secondary to the problem I describe below).
When I run the failing test from the QA branch, it is shown as skipped:
./vendor/bin/phpunit -c phpunit.xml.nocoverage
test/Environment_test.php
There was 1 skipped test:
1) Environment_Test::testMySQL
Error: SQLSTATE[HY000] [1045] Access denied for user 'root'@'localhost'
(using password: NO)
However, from master, it fails:
./vendor/bin/phpunit -c phpunit.xml.nocoverage
test/EnvironmentTest.php
There was 1 error:
1) PhpMyAdmin\Tests\EnvironmentTest::testMySQL
PDOException: SQLSTATE[HY000] [1045] Access denied for user
'root'@'localhost'
(using password: NO)
I don't see anything obvious that would make these two behave
differently. Do you have any thoughts to help me out?
